Original and Paper 4 Hold down the four corners of the envelopes firmly, so that they and the sealed or glued portion stay flat. 5 Load the envelopes, as shown below. Feeding Direction The screen for selecting the paper size appears. ` - Do not print on the back side of the envelopes (the side with the flap (A)). - If the envelopes become filled with air, flatten them by hand before loading them into the stack bypass. - The stack bypass can hold 10 envelopes at a time. - Envelopes may be creased in the printing process. 4 Specify the size and the type of the paper you load. For details on how to specify the paper size and type, see "Setting Paper Size and Type for the Stack Bypass," on p. 2‑21. The paper size/type setting in the [Stack Bypass] setting screen is available if Stack Bypass Standard Settings is set to [Off] in Common Settings (from the Additional Functions screen). If Stack Bypass Standard Settings is set to [On], copying can be performed only for the registered paper size and type. (See, "Setting Paper Size and Type," on p. 2‑19.) 2‑18
